The 151st Pokémon (Mew) can only be obtained through a glitch in the game or an official distribution by Nintendo. As such, it is a highly-sought after and elusive Pokémon. In Pokémon Yellow, released in 1998 in Japan and 2000 in North America and Europe, players receive a Pikachu as their starter Pokémon, which visually follows behind the player on the overworld.

Additionally, certain actions taken by the player can influence Pikachu’s behavior towards them. If players turn around and speak with Pikachu, it will grow to either love or hate the player depending on their actions. This allows for players to have a deeper connection with their favorite Pokémon as they adventure through the game.
